Can You Wash White Clothes Without Bleach?

White clothes are difficult to clean, but you can maintain their brightness without resorting to bleach. While bleach can be an effective way to clean clothes, it can be toxic and harsh on delicate fabrics. Thankfully, there are several natural approaches to cleaning white clothes without using bleach or other harsh chemicals.

Here are some ideas:

  • Opt for a cold wash cycle with a mild detergent to maintain the fabric’s quality.
  • Add 1 cup of vinegar to the laundry to help bring out the whites.
  • For a deep stain, mix a paste of baking soda and water, apply to the material and scrub lightly.
  • Soak the clothes for an hour in a mixture of oxygen bleach and water.
  • Hang your white clothes in the sunshine to help whiten them naturally.

Whether you’re removing tough stains or just want to clean your whites, you can do it naturally. While bleach may seem like the go-to cleaning solution, it can cause damage and deterioration to fabric over time. For a safe and effective way to make your whites stay bright, try any of the natural alternatives above and keep your laundry looking like new.
